How much do offshore baker j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 9, 2026, the average hourly pay for offshore baker in the United States is $14.90,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$12.50 and $16.35 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the typical working conditions and schedule like for an Offshore Baker?

As an Offshore Baker, you will usually work on a rotational schedule, such as two weeks on followed by two weeks off, living and working on offshore platforms or vessels during your shifts. The working environment is fast-paced and requires baking for large crews, often in well-equipped but compact kitchens. Teamwork with other galley staff, including chefs and kitchen assistants, is essential to coordinate meal times and ensure food safety standards are met. The remote nature of the job means flexibility and resilience are important, but it's also an opportunity to build strong camaraderie and gain experience in an essential, high-demand field.

What is an Offshore Baker job?

An Offshore Baker is responsible for preparing and baking a variety of bread, pastries, and other baked goods for crew members on offshore rigs or vessels. They work in remote environments, ensuring meals are of high quality and meet dietary requirements. Their duties include mixing ingredients, operating baking equipment, and maintaining kitchen hygiene. Offshore Bakers must follow strict safety protocols due to the unique challenges of working at sea.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Offshore Baker position,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Offshore Baker, you need strong baking skills, food safety knowledge, and prior experience in large-scale catering, often supported by certifications such as a food handler's permit or HACCP training. Familiarity with industrial kitchen equipment and inventory management systems is typically required. Attention to detail, adaptability, and effective communication are valuable soft skills when working in remote, team-based environments. These competencies are crucial for consistently delivering high-quality baked goods and meals under the unique challenges of offshore operations.

What You’ll Do:  As a Offshore Baker at Sodexo, you will prepare baked goods according to recipes and production specifications. They will follow all Sodexo culinary standards to ensure that pastry and bakery items are of the highest quality in taste and appearance to satisfy guests. The general responsibilities of the position include those listed below, but Sodexo may identify other responsibilities of the position. These responsibilities may differ among accounts, depending on business necessities and client requirements. 


Responsibilities include:  

  • Check daily production schedules and follow Sodexo recipes to prepare a variety of baked items from scratch, such as breads, rolls, muffins, biscuits, cakes, and pastries.  
  • Accurately weigh and measure ingredients, mix doughs and batters by hand or mixer, shape and cut dough, and bake items to perfection.  
  • Regulate oven temperatures, monitor baking times, and ensure all products are prepared, held, and served at correct temperatures.  
  • Set up and stock the bake shop area, maintain proper storage, rotation, labeling, and dating of all products, and keep the bakery clean and organized.  
  • Pay close attention to detail, accommodate special requests, and ensure only high-quality baked items leave the kitchen. 
  • Significant walking or other means of mobility. 
  • Must be able to use hands to finger, handle, feel, reach with hands and arms, and taste or smell. 
  • Ability to walk or stand for extended periods of time, throughout the entire duration of a shift, which may exceed 8 hours.  
  • Ability to reach, bend, stoop, push and/or pull, and frequently lift up to 35 pounds and occasionally lift/move 50 pounds.
